
Prakhar Awasthi
Natural Sciences / Molecular Biology & Genetics
AD Scientific Index ID: 5463060
राष्ट्रीय संयंत्र जीनोम अनुसंधान संस्थान
person_outline
Prakhar Awasthi's MOST POPULAR ARTICLES